Details of the original alert: At 04:37 pm, MetService weather radar detected a line of severe thunderstorms lying from AWARUA to TITOKI to WAIOTIRA. This line of severe thunderstorms is moving towards the eastsoutheast, and is expected to lie from NUKUTAWHITI to TANGITERORIA to TAIPUHA at 05:07 pm and from MOENGAWAHINE to MAUNGAKARAMEA to MAUNGATUROTO at 05:37 pm. These thunderstorms are expected to be accompanied by torrential rain. Impact: Torrential rain can cause surface and/or flash flooding about streams, gullies and urban areas, and make driving conditions extremely hazardous. The National Emergency Management Agency advises that as storms approach you should: - Take shelter, preferably indoors away from windows; - Avoid sheltering under trees, if outside; - Get back to land, if outdoors on the water; - Move cars under cover or away from trees; - Secure any loose objects around your property; - Check that drains and gutters are clear; - Be ready to slow down or stop, if driving. During and after the storm, you should also: - Beware of fallen trees and power lines; - Avoid streams and drains as you may be swept away in flash flooding.
